The scientific name for rat bite fever is Streptobacillus moniliformis in the United States and Spirillum minus in Asia. It is an infectious disease that can be transmitted through bites or scratches from infected rats or through contact with their bodily fluids. Symptoms may include fever, rash, and joint pain. Prompt medical treatment is important to prevent complications.
